The average insurance rates for an Audi S6 are $1,338 a year for full coverage insurance. Comprehensive costs approximately $274 a year, collision costs $428, and liability insurance is estimated at $478. Buying just liability costs approximately $526 a year, with insurance for high-risk drivers costing around $2,892. 16-year-old drivers cost the most to insure at $5,096 a year or more.

Average premium for full coverage: $1,338

Policy rates by type of insurance:

Comprehensive $274
Collision $428
Liability $478

Price estimates include $500 policy deductibles, split liability limits of 30/60, and includes additional medical/uninsured motorist coverage. Prices are averaged for all 50 states and S6 trim levels.

For the average 40-year-old driver, Audi S6 insurance rates go from the low end price of $526 for just the minimum liability insurance to a high of $2,892 for coverage for higher-risk drivers.

Liability Only $526
Full Coverage $1,338
High Risk $2,892

Living in a larger city has a significant impact on the price of auto insurance. Rural locations are shown to have lower incidents of physical damage claims than congested cities.

The diagram below illustrates the difference location can make on auto insurance prices.

Rural Areas $1,004
Small Cities $1,405
Large Cities $1,806

Insurance rates for an Audi S6 also range considerably based on the trim level of your S6, your age and driving record, and physical damage deductibles and liability limits.

If you have a few points on your driving record or you caused an accident, you are probably paying anywhere from $1,600 to $2,200 extra every year, depending on your age. A high-risk auto insurance policy ranges anywhere from 43% to 133% more than the average rate. View High Risk Driver Rates

Older drivers with a clean driving record and higher comprehensive and collision deductibles could pay as little as $1,200 annually on average, or $100 per month, for full coverage. Rates are highest for teenagers, since even teens with perfect driving records can expect to pay in the ballpark of $5,000 a year. View Rates by Age

Your home state plays a big part in determining prices for Audi S6 insurance rates. A good driver about age 40 could pay as low as $880 a year in states like North Carolina, Wisconsin, and Vermont, or at least $1,810 on average in Florida, New York, and Michigan.

Opting for high physical damage deductibles can save as much as $470 each year, while buying higher liability limits will push rates upward. Switching from a 50/100 bodily injury protection limit to a 250/500 limit will raise rates by up to $430 more per year. View Rates by Deductible or Liability Limit

How to Find Cheaper Audi S6 Insurance

Finding cheaper rates on Audi S6 insurance takes being a good driver, having above-average credit, being claim-free, and maximizing policy discounts. Comparison shop at least once a year by requesting rates from direct insurance companies, and also from your local car insurance providers.

The following list is a condensed summary of the primary concepts that were touched on in this article.

  • It is possible to save around $160 per year simply by quoting early and online
  • High-risk drivers with multiple at-fault accidents could be charged and average of $1,550 more per year than a safer driver
  • Increasing comprehensive and collision deductibles can save approximately $475 each year
  • Drivers age 16 to 20 are expensive to insure, possibly costing $425 each month if full coverage is included
